Pedestal Grinder Maintenance (Weekly)
Service manual: https://drive.google.com/file/d/1QgkvdwpKXrfAl8W_3rSlNlg2mLRIDCh6/view*Task List*1. Check the spacing between the tool rests and the grinding wheels. (The spacing should be less than 1/16 of an inch, never more than 1/8 Inch.)2. Adjust the tool...

Vertical Metal Bandsaw - Weekly
Service manual: https://drive.google.com/file/d/1YgGuXN2GB-ZQffNzAmpv5Zo6hYNJFlxi/view?usp=drive_link*Task List*- With a thumb or cloth, check for grease on the shaft of the upper blade guide and no accumulated debris. Reapply with grease from the grease gun i...
